What does a data project manager do?

A Data Project Manager oversees data-related projects, ensuring they are completed on time, within budget, and according to specified requirements. They coordinate teams of data analysts, engineers, and other stakeholders to collect, manage, and analyze data. Their responsibilities include project planning, risk management, resource allocation, and communication with clients or leadership. Data Project Managers play a crucial role in transforming raw data into actionable insights for organizations.

How does a data project manager typically collaborate with data analysts, engineers, and stakeholders during a project lifecycle?

A Data Project Manager acts as the central point of coordination between technical teams—like data analysts and engineers—and business stakeholders. They facilitate regular meetings to clarify project goals, align on deliverables, and resolve blockers swiftly. The role often involves translating business requirements into actionable tasks for the technical team, monitoring progress, and ensuring that communication flows smoothly among all parties. This collaborative approach helps ensure data projects are delivered on time and meet organizational objectives.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a data project man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Data Project Manager, you need strong project management abilities, data analysis skills, and a relevant degree in business, information technology, or a related field. Familiarity with project management tools (like Jira or Asana), data visualization platforms (such as Tableau or Power BI), and certifications like PMP or Agile/Scrum are commonly required. Exceptional communication, leadership, and problem-solving skills help drive cross-functional collaboration and resolve complex project challenges. These skills are crucial for ensuring projects are delivered on time, data is leveraged effectively, and stakeholder expectations are met.

What is the difference between Data Project Manager vs Data Analyst?

AspectData Project ManagerData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Business, IT, or related field; PMP or project management certifications often preferredBachelor's in Statistics, Mathematics, or related field; often requires proficiency in data analysis tools
Work EnvironmentOversees projects, manages teams, coordinates between stakeholdersAnalyzes data sets, creates reports, visualizations, and insights
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across industries for managing data projects in tech, finance, healthcareCommonly employed for data interpretation and reporting roles in similar industries

The Data Project Manager focuses on planning, executing, and closing data-related projects, ensuring timely delivery and stakeholder communication. In contrast, a Data Analyst primarily interprets data, creates reports, and provides insights. Both roles require strong analytical skills, but their responsibilities and focus areas differ significantly.

PROJECT MANAGER

SOUTHFIELD, MICHIGAN - WORLD HEADQUARTERS

We are seeking a highly experienced Project Manager with deep expertise in enterpriselevel Change Management to lead complex, crossfunctional initiatives across our global organization. This role is ideal for a seasoned program or project leader who excels at driving strategic outcomes, navigating global stakeholder environments, and ensuring that largescale transformations are adopted, sustained, and successful. You will oversee endtoend project delivery, balancing scope, timeline, cost, and quality, while also serving as the change leader who ensures people, processes, and systems are ready for transformation. This role requires exceptional communication skills, executive presence, and experience working across multiple regions, cultures, and business lines.

 

Your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Business, Management, HR, Information Systems, or related field; Master's degree preferred.
  • 7-10+ years of project or program management experience in a global, matrixed enterprise.
  • Proven expertise in enterpriselevel Change Management planning and execution.
  • Strong command of project management methodologies (e.g., PMI, Agile, hybrid).
  • Experience driving large-scale, cross-functional transformation initiatives.
  • Demonstrated success managing executive stakeholders and global teams.
  • Exceptional communication, facilitation, and influencing skills.
  • High proficiency in project tools (e.g., MS Project, Smartsheet, Jira, Confluence, PowerPoint, Excel).
  • Fluent in English
  • PMP, SCRUM, PgMP, Prosci, CCMP, or similar certifications.
  • Experience working across multiple geographies, cultures, and time zones.
  • Background in HR Transformation, Digital Transformation, Technology Adoption, or Organizational Effectiveness.
  • Familiarity with enterprise platforms (e.g., Workday, SAP, Salesforce, ServiceNow).
  • Strong analytical skills with ability to interpret data and drive informed decisions.
  • Executive presence with strong storytelling skills.
  • High emotional intelligence and ability to influence without authority.
  • Strategic thinking with a hands-on, getthingsdone approach.
  • Ability to thrive in ambiguity and lead teams through change.
  • Strong relationshipbuilding and collaboration skills

Your work will include, but not be limited to:

  • Lead complex, multiworkstream projects from initiation through deployment and sustainment.
  • Define project scope, success metrics, timelines, dependencies, and resource plans in partnership with sponsors and global stakeholders.
  • Manage project risks, issues, and interdependencies; develop mitigation and contingency strategies.
  • Ensure disciplined project governance and reporting through Steering Committees, PMO frameworks, and executive updates.
  • Drive strategic alignment across regions, functions, and senior leaders to ensure unified execution.
  • Develop and execute comprehensive change management strategies including stakeholder assessments, readiness planning, communications, and adoption plans.
  • Assess organizational impact and define strategies to support people, process, and technology transitions.
  • Lead global change networks, SME communities, and business readiness workstreams.
  • Create and deliver communication materials, training plans, leadership engagement strategies, and resistancemanagement approaches.
  • Embed change management best practices to ensure long-term sustainability and measurable adoption.
  • Partner with senior leaders to define vision, secure alignment, and manage expectations throughout the project lifecycle.
  • Facilitate workshops, decisionmaking sessions, and global collaboration forums.
  • Build trusted relationships across regions and functions, acting as a connector between technology, operations, HR, and business teams.
  • Communicate complex topics in clear, concise, and audienceappropriate ways.
  • Ensure project deliverables meet quality standards and support strategic objectives.
  • Implement and optimize PMO processes, tools, and methodologies.
  • Track KPIs, benefits realization, and organizational outcomes.
  • Promote continuous improvement and knowledge sharing across the transformation and PMO community.
